Tennessee has 10 CSWE-accredited MSW programs distributed across the state's major population centers and its Appalachian region. The University of Tennessee at Knoxville, with 1945 accreditation, is the oldest and most research-intensive program in the state, offering an MSSW (Master of Science in Social Work) degree across Knoxville, a Nashville hybrid evening track, and online delivery. The University of Memphis serves the state's largest city with six dual-degree options and a broad range of graduate certificates. East Tennessee State University in Johnson City covers the Appalachian Tri-Cities region at the intersection of Tennessee, Virginia, and North Carolina.

Three programs, Austin Peay State University, Middle Tennessee State University, and Tennessee State University, share a 2009 accreditation year as former members of a Tennessee collaborative MSW program that operated jointly until 2021. Each has since developed a distinct institutional identity. TSU is the state's only HBCU MSW program, anchored in Nashville. MTSU operates from Murfreesboro in Tennessee's fastest-growing county. Austin Peay in Clarksville serves a military community adjacent to Fort Campbell and offers a Trauma concentration specifically suited to that context.

Tennessee's four-tier licensing structure (LBSW, LMSW, LCSW, LAPSW) means that MSW graduates begin as LMSW holders and use that credential to accumulate the supervised clinical hours required for the LCSW, the independent clinical practice license. The LMSW is an intermediate step on the path to clinical licensure, not a standalone endpoint for most practitioners pursuing clinical practice. Students should plan to secure LMSW-supervised employment immediately after graduation to begin accumulating hours efficiently.

    The University of Tennessee College of Social Work has held CSWE accreditation since 1945, the oldest social work program in Tennessee. The degree is titled Master of Science in Social Work (MSSW), a CSWE-accredited social work credential; prospective students should confirm with the Tennessee Board of Social Worker Licensure that the MSSW satisfies LMSW and LCSW licensure requirements (as a CSWE-accredited social work master's degree, it is expected to qualify). Two concentrations are offered: Clinical Practice and Organizational Leadership. The College describes the Organizational Leadership track as the only macro-focused social work program in Tennessee, preparing graduates for nonprofit and government agency leadership roles. Three dual-degree programs are available: MSSW/JD, MSSW/MLS (Master of Legal Studies), and MSSW/MBA. Five graduate certificates are offered: Forensic Social Work, Gerontology, School Social Work, Trauma Treatment, and Veterinary Social Work. The program operates from the Knoxville main campus, a Nashville hybrid evening track (meeting in-person every other week with asynchronous online coursework), and an online track added in 2018. Advanced Standing is available. UTK is the flagship R1 research university of the University of Tennessee System.

    The University of Memphis School of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2011 and offers an Advanced Practice Across Systems concentration, an advanced generalist approach preparing graduates for evidence-based practice with multiple populations and systems. Multiple program tracks are available: full-time (2 years), spring start (2.5 years), extended study (3-4 years), Advanced Standing full-time (1 year), and Advanced Standing extended (2 years). An online track was added in 2018. Six dual-degree programs are offered per the CSWE directory: MSW/MS (Criminal Justice), MSW/Nonprofit Management, MSW/MPA (Public Administration), MSW/MPH (Public Health), MSW/MURP (Urban Planning), and at least one additional joint degree, the broadest dual-degree menu of any Tennessee program. Four graduate certificates are available: School Social Work, Clinical Social Work, Substance Abuse, and Play Therapy. Advanced Standing is available. Memphis is Tennessee's largest city. Methodist Le Bonheur Healthcare, Regional One Health, and the Shelby County Department of Children's Services anchor the Memphis social work practicum and employment network.

    East Tennessee State University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2003 and offers a Clinical Practice concentration. An online track was added in 2021. Advanced Standing is available. ETSU is a public university in Johnson City in Northeast Tennessee, in the Appalachian Tri-Cities region (Johnson City, Kingsport, Bristol). Cross-state sites in Abingdon, Virginia and Asheville, North Carolina, which operated from 2003 to 2021 and extended the program into the Virginia Highlands and Western North Carolina Appalachian communities, closed in 2021. The Johnson City campus is served by Ballad Health, one of the largest hospital systems in the central Appalachian region, providing strong clinical practicum placement infrastructure. ETSU graduates have cross-state labor market access across the TN-VA-NC tri-state region. No dual-degree programs are listed in the CSWE directory.

    Tennessee State University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2009 as part of the Tennessee collaborative MSW program (with MTSU and Austin Peay), which operated jointly from 2009 to 2021; TSU has held independent CSWE accreditation since 2021. An Advanced Generalist concentration is offered. No online delivery is currently offered. No dual-degree programs are listed in the CSWE directory. Advanced Standing is available. TSU is a historically Black university in Nashville, Tennessee's capital and largest city. Nashville's social work labor market is anchored by Vanderbilt University Medical Center, HCA Healthcare (headquartered in Nashville), the Tennessee Department of Children's Services, and a large network of nonprofit social services organizations. TSU's HBCU identity and its location in the state capital position the program to serve a significant Black community and policy-engaged workforce in one of the fastest-growing cities in the South.

    Middle Tennessee State University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2009 as part of the Tennessee collaborative MSW program with TSU and Austin Peay, operating jointly from 2009 to 2021; MTSU has held independent CSWE accreditation since 2021. An Advanced Generalist concentration is offered. A dual-degree program is available per the CSWE directory. Nashville and Clarksville sites that operated under the collaborative through 2021 have closed; the program now operates from the Murfreesboro main campus. No online delivery is currently offered. Advanced Standing is available. MTSU is a public university in Murfreesboro, approximately 30 miles southeast of Nashville in Rutherford County, one of the fastest-growing counties in Tennessee. MTSU has the highest total undergraduate enrollment of any university in Tennessee, providing a large student network and proximity to Nashville's social work practicum ecosystem.

    Union University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2008 and operates from two campus locations: Jackson (main campus in West Tennessee) and Germantown (a Memphis suburb), with an online track added in 2021. An Advanced Generalist concentration is offered. A dual MSW/MBA degree is available. Advanced Standing is available. Union University is a private Christian institution in Jackson, Tennessee. The Jackson campus serves West Tennessee's social work workforce needs beyond Memphis, covering a region of rural communities, small cities, and agricultural counties with limited MSW access points. The Germantown campus provides Union a Memphis metropolitan presence alongside the University of Memphis program.

    Austin Peay State University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2009 as part of the Tennessee collaborative MSW program with MTSU and TSU, operating jointly from 2009 to 2021; APSU has held independent CSWE accreditation since 2021. Two concentrations are offered: Advanced Generalist and Trauma. The Trauma concentration is one of a small number nationally and addresses the clinical and community practice needs of a population heavily shaped by military service. An online track has been available since 2018. A Springfield, TN site that operated under the collaborative from 2009 to 2021 has closed. Advanced Standing is available. Austin Peay is a public university in Clarksville, adjacent to Fort Campbell, the home installation of the 101st Airborne Division. The proximity to Fort Campbell creates a substantial demand for military social work, veterans behavioral health, and family services practitioners that the Trauma concentration directly addresses. No dual-degree programs are listed in the CSWE directory.

    Southern Adventist University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2010 and initially operated from the Collegedale campus in Southeast Tennessee near Chattanooga. The program transitioned to fully online delivery in 2021 when the campus site closed. An Advanced Generalist concentration is offered. A dual MSW/MBA degree is available. Advanced Standing is available. Southern Adventist University is a Seventh-day Adventist institution in Collegedale, Tennessee. The fully online format makes the program accessible to students nationally. Students arrange local field placements in their home communities regardless of their geographic location. No additional dual-degree programs beyond the MSW/MBA are listed in the CSWE directory.

    The University of Tennessee at Chattanooga's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2016. An Advanced Generalist concentration is offered. No online delivery is currently offered. No dual-degree programs are listed in the CSWE directory. Advanced Standing is available. UTC is a campus of the University of Tennessee System and is located in Chattanooga in Southeast Tennessee. The Chattanooga metro has a growing healthcare and nonprofit social services sector anchored by CHI Memorial and Erlanger Health System, as well as significant immigrant and refugee community organizations, outdoor and adventure therapy services, and a rapidly expanding technology and corporate sector creating new social work workforce demand. UTC is the only public CSWE-accredited MSW program with a campus in Chattanooga.

    King University's Department of Social Work received CSWE accreditation in 2021, the most recently accredited MSW program in Tennessee. The program previously operated from a Bristol, Tennessee campus, which closed in 2023; the program is now fully online. Advanced Standing is available. King University is a private liberal arts institution affiliated with the Presbyterian Church (U.S.A.) and headquartered in Bristol, Tennessee, on the Tennessee-Virginia state line. No dual-degree programs are listed in the CSWE directory. As the most recently accredited program in the state, its short accreditation history limits its composite score relative to longer-established programs. The fully online format makes it accessible to students across Tennessee and beyond who prefer distance learning.

Job Market for MSW Graduates in Tennessee

Tennessee's social work labor market is divided between two major metropolitan centers. Nashville is the state capital and largest city, with a healthcare sector dominated by HCA Healthcare (the nation's largest for-profit hospital system, headquartered in Nashville), Vanderbilt University Medical Center, and the state's mental health and child welfare agencies (Tennessee Department of Children's Services, Tennessee Department of Mental Health and Substance Abuse Services). Nashville's rapid population growth over the past decade has expanded both nonprofit and healthcare social work demand substantially.

Memphis is Tennessee's second social work labor market, with Methodist Le Bonheur Healthcare, Regional One Health (a Level I trauma center), and the Shelby County Department of Children's Services as major employers. Memphis has some of the highest poverty rates of any large U.S. city, which corresponds to strong and persistent demand for social workers in community mental health, poverty services, and child welfare.

Outside the two major metros, the Knoxville area has University of Tennessee Medical Center and a network of Appalachian community health centers. The Chattanooga metro is a growing market anchored by CHI Memorial and Erlanger Health. Northeast Tennessee (Johnson City, Kingsport, Bristol) is served by Ballad Health, which operates 20 hospitals across the TN-VA region. The Fort Campbell corridor (Clarksville, TN and Oak Grove, KY) creates distinctive military social work employment, particularly in behavioral health, family services, and trauma-informed care.

How We Ranked These Programs

Each program is scored on the same seven-factor model used in the national ranking. The state ranking uses identical criteria and weights. No Tennessee-specific adjustments are made. Programs are ordered by composite score. For the full methodology, see our ranking methodology page.

  • CSWE Accreditation (25%): Active accreditation status and continuous accreditation history.
  • Program Leadership (15%): Faculty credentials, research output, and peer-assessment scores.
  • Pathways (15%): Concentration variety, Advanced Standing availability, and dual-degree options.
  • Delivery Format (15%): Online, hybrid, and in-person availability; start-term flexibility.
  • Employer Signal (15%): Field placement hours required, practicum site depth, and documented placement infrastructure.
  • Cost & Affordability (10%): Published tuition per credit or per year, in-state vs. out-of-state differential.
  • Reputation (5%): U.S. News peer-assessment scores and institutional recognition.
